V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X 提问指南
AS58453
V2EX  ›  问与答

问大家一个 jellyfin 服务端外部访问的问题

  •  
  •   AS58453 · 2023-09-07 11:12:49 +08:00 · 1082 次点击
    这是一个创建于 447 天前的主题,其中的信息可能已经有所发展或是发生改变。
    windows 平台,之前使用的 OPENWRT 固件的路由器,现在换成了华硕的路由器。网络环境是固定 IPV4+IPV6 双公网。之前使用 IPV4 和 IPV6 都可以成功访问到 jellyfin 服务器。(外部网络,非内部)。更换路由器后就遇到一个问题:服务器设置中在开启 IPV4 和 IPV6 访问的话就只可以在 IPV6 下使用,使用公网 IPV4 在外部网络访问会无法自动发现服务器。清空浏览器缓存不管用。手动添加地址也是无法连接,提示请确定服务器是否在运行;如果在服务器设置中把 IPV6 关掉的话,那么 IPV4 在外部的访问就会正常。但是再打开 IPV6 的话,使用 IPV4 连接就会无法发现服务器。防火墙已经关闭,但是如果和服务器在用一个局域网中(也就是家中),那么不管是 IPV4 还是 IPV6 就都可以发现服务器并且连接上..............我确定没有连通性问题;路由器端口映射正确,并且也关了防火墙,也尝试按照官方文档映射了 1900/UDP 自动发现端口,还是不能使用。大家知道问题在哪吗? 对了 不是 docker 部署的。就是直接运行在服务器中,windows 版本。也重新安装过 jellyfin 服务器端(完全卸载,清空所有数据),也是一样的问题。
    3 条回复    2023-09-08 12:49:39 +08:00
    linuxgo
        1
    linuxgo  
       2023-09-07 11:45:05 +08:00
    既然是更换路由器后出现问题,那就重点检查路由器的配置有什么不一样。另外既然 ipv6 可以访问,为何还纠结 ipv4 ?
    AS58453
        2
    AS58453  
    OP
       2023-09-07 12:11:10 +08:00 via Android
    @linuxgo 不是每个地方都有 ipv6 有重度远程访问需求。
    路由器配置没有问题的。就是单纯的感觉服务器软件有问题。关了 ipv6 就能用 v4 访问了。证明端口转发是没有问题的。
    AS58453
        3
    AS58453  
    OP
       2023-09-08 12:49:39 +08:00
    后续:问题解决;原因居然是我服务器用的静态 IP+静态 ipv6 ;改回 DHCP——无状态分配就全部正常了。应该是 jellyfin 的 BUG ;
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   4103 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 33ms · UTC 05:15 · PVG 13:15 · LAX 21:15 · JFK 00:15
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.